Understanding GA3's chemical blueprint prevents costly formulation errors. The white crystalline powder (molecular formula C19H22O6) maintains stability only when stored below 25°C in airtight containers.
Always verify CAS 77-06-5 on certificates of analysis. This 346.38 g/mol diterpenoid contains reactive carboxyl groups demanding pH-controlled solutions. Counterfeit products often lack the characteristic melting point of 227°C - a simple hot-stage microscope test protects your investment.
The 1.34 g/cm³ density enables efficient shipping, but moisture sensitivity requires triple-layer packaging. Pro tip: Request oxygen-absorbent sachets in bulk shipments - Brazilian coffee processors extended powder shelf-life by 11 months using this protocol.

Precision avoids the yellowing and elongation seen in mismanaged operations.
Wheat fields showing chlorosis after GA3 treatment indicate concentration errors. Pakistani agronomists solved this by calibrating sprayers monthly and maintaining strict 30-40ppm limits during jointing stage. Yield increases held at 18% without quality loss.
Citrus applications exceeding 20ppm cause abnormal leaf elongation. Florida growers now use digital syringe adapters for tank mixing, reducing dosage errors from 12% to under 2%. Resulting fruit met EU maximum residue levels (MRLs) of 0.05ppm effortlessly.
